Output e8996b16c8ad2b4a5102d6082a29ee279cf3727eb8febc39d143fff65920f955:95

value
164770
script pubkey
OP_0 OP_PUSHBYTES_32 de0b81ba1ee0a1bee67c2663201867ae96302a803c539386064aae10bd85637f
address
bc1qmc9crws7uzsmaenuye3jqxr846trq25q83fe8psxf2hpp0v9vdlsu4ykuy
transaction
e8996b16c8ad2b4a5102d6082a29ee279cf3727eb8febc39d143fff65920f955
spent
true